Frédéric Worms is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, General Health Professions and Philosophy. According to data from OpenAlex, Frédéric Worms has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 71 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Clinical Psychology, 9 papers in General Health Professions and 8 papers in Philosophy. Recurrent topics in Frédéric Worms’s work include Health, Medicine and Society (8 papers), Philosophical and Theoretical Analysis (8 papers) and Psychoanalysis and Psychopathology Research (8 papers). Frédéric Worms is often cited by papers focused on Health, Medicine and Society (8 papers), Philosophical and Theoretical Analysis (8 papers) and Psychoanalysis and Psychopathology Research (8 papers). Frédéric Worms collaborates with scholars based in France, United Kingdom and Burundi. Frédéric Worms's co-authors include Judith Butler and Renaud Barbaras and has published in prestigious journals such as MLN, Angelaki and Esprit.
